AUTOMATIC TIMER

RECORDING

The VCR’s automatic timer lets you program it to select an input source, start recording from that source at a time you set, then stop record- ing at a time you set. You can set up to eight program timers to record any combination of weekly, daily, or one-time events.

You can set the VCR to record at any time on a specific day within a 1-month period, at the same time Monday through Friday (DAILY), or at the same time on the same day every week (WEEKLY).

Notes:

The VCR can record only one broadcast at a time. If you program the VCR’s timer to record broadcasts on different channels that start at the same time, the VCR only records the program that has the lowest program number.

If two timer programs overlap, the one that starts first has priority. The VCR begins recording the second program after the first program ends.

The VCR must be off at the programmed time for it to make an automatic timer recording.

If there is a power failure of more than 3 minutes during a timer recording, the recording does not resume after power is restored.

If there is a power failure of more than 3 minutes before a programmed start time, the VCR loses the clock setting and there- fore does not start automatic timer record- ing. However, if you have an EDS channel in your area and set the VCR to automati- cally set the clock from the EDS signal, the clock is reset within 10 minutes after power is restored, and the VCR records at the programmed time(s).

Setting the Program Timer

Note: To program the timers, you can use the VCR’s front panel buttons instead of the re- mote control. Use PLAY as SEL s, REW as SEL t, and FF as SET.

1.Turn on the VCR and the TV.

Note: If you use a TV/monitor that is con- nected to the VCR’s AUDIO/VIDEO OUT jacks, set it to the video mode and skip Steps 2 and 3.

2.Set the TV to the same channel as the VCR’s 3 CH. 4 switch.

3.Press TV/VCR until the VCR displays VCR.

4.(Model 60 only) Set the audio recording mode to the desired setting. See “Receiv- ing/Recording Stereo/SAP Broadcasts (Model 60 Only)” on Page 27.

5.Insert a blank cassette, or one that you want to record over, into the VCR.

6.Press PROG on the remote control. The TV displays the timer setting menu.

Note: If the clock is not set, the screen shows PLEASE SET CLOCK BEFORE PROGRAMMING and then goes to the clock-setting screen. Set the clock as described under “Manually Setting the Clock” on Page 16.

7.If you have already entered a program(s), the current settings for the first four pro- grams appear on the display. Press SEL s/t to select an empty program number, then press SET. The TV displays the program menu.
